The Prince of Spies is a captivating Christian historical romance novel by award-winning author Elizabeth Camden, set in the glamorous yet politically charged world of Gilded Age Washington, D.C. in 1902. It is the third and final book in the acclaimed Hope and Glory series, but stands as a richly satisfying read even on its own. The story centers on Luke Delacroix, a former government spy turned magazine journalist, who is on a secret mission in Congress to bring down his greatest enemy.
Everything changes when Luke meets Marianne Magruder, a spirited government photographer with remarkable wit and daring. Their chemistry is instant, their connection undeniable. But when they discover their family names, the truth is devastating: they are heirs to a bitter, generations-long feud that makes their love feel completely impossible. Think Romeo and Juliet set against the backdrop of food safety reform and Capitol Hill intrigue.
Elizabeth Camden masterfully weaves real historical events into the romance, including the fascinating story of the Poison Squad and the fight for the Pure Food and Drug Act. The result is a novel that is equal parts tender love story and gripping political thriller. Both Luke and Marianne are beautifully developed characters, complex, courageous, and deeply human.
